バックグラウンド: | This gene belongs to the methyltransferase superfamily, and is located in the pseudoautosomal region (PAR) at the end of the short arms of the X and Y chromosomes. The encoded enzyme catalyzes the final reaction in the synthesis of melatonin, and is abundant in the pineal gland. Alternatively spliced transcript variants have been noted for this gene. |
UniProt Protein Function: | ASMT: Produces melatonin (N-acetyl-5-methoxytryptamine) from N-acetylserotonin. Belongs to the methyltransferase superfamily. 3 isoforms of the human protein are produced by alternative splicing. |
